He was the principal bass player of the Midland Sinfonia, Academy of St. Martin in the Fields, and English Chamber Orchestra, founder (with Amelia Freedman) of the Nash Ensemble, and has been a principal player in other early music ensembles. He is also a publisher of sheet music for double bass.<ref name=Wwho>International who's who in music and musicians' directory, p. 599</ref> He had studied with Adrian Beers and wrote his obituary in The Independent.
